I have a TabHost with a ListView inside a tab. When the activity starts, I can’t scroll the list view until I have clicked off the tab that the activity starts on, and then re-select the tab with the list view inside it.

Note, I can get the list view to focus by calling:
tabHost.getTabContentView().requestFocus(); but unfortunately, I still can’t scroll until I have reselected the tab…

Have any remedies?
